procurations

[US]/ˌprɒk.jʊˈreɪ.ʃən/
[UK]/ˌprɑː.kjʊˈreɪ.ʃən/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

n.the act of obtaining or acquiring something; the act of delegating authority or power; the right or power to act on behalf of another; commission or fee for services rendered; the act of pimping
